What the charity does
The DH9 Foundation was established in memory of David Hill who died at the age of 30 from an undiagnosed heart condition. Following a robust process, the DH9 Foundation became a registered Scottish charity, through OSCR, on 2 December 2024. The DH9 Foundation aims to: · Raise awareness of young sudden cardiac death · Provide CPR training and defibrillators to schools and community organisations in Dumfries and Galloway · Fund cardiac screening through Cardiac Risk in the Young (CRY) The DH9 Foundation is committed to improving the cardiac health of young people under the age of 35.
